본문 바로가기
Javascript

jQuery element에 어떤 이벤트가 있는지 확인하는 방법

by @hohoya33 2021년 04월 26일

제이쿼리에서 엘리먼트에 정의된 이벤트를 확인 할 수 있습니다.

var events = $._data(element, 'events');

 

아래 코드를 실행하면 해당 버튼에 어떤 이벤트가 있는지 확인할 수 있습니다.

<button type="button" id="demo">This is demo text</button>
$("#demo").click(function() {
  console.log("Does event exists? - " + hasEvents);
});

var events = $._data($("#demo")[0], "events");
var hasEvents = (events != null);

 

개의 댓글